Allentown, PA vs Hickory, NC
Hickory, NC is more affordable
| Metric | Allentown, PA | Hickory, NC |
|---|---|---|
| Cost of Living Index | 100.0 | 88.5 |
| Housing Index | 105.5 | 59.6 |
| Goods Index | 100.6 | 96.6 |
| Utilities Index | 107.6 | 87.8 |
| Median Income | $78,597 | $57,943 |
| Median Home Value | $258,000 | $172,700 |
| Median Rent | $1,246 | $797 |
| Per Capita Income | $41,178 | $31,932 |
Is Allentown, PA or Hickory, NC cheaper?
Hickory, NC is more affordable with a cost of living index of 88.5 vs 100.0.
